
Game Overview
A quiet home becomes the stage for a surprisingly personal kind of puzzle-solving, where every misplaced mug, book, toy, and keepsake asks to be understood before it is put away. Organized Inside is a gentle indie simulation built around the satisfaction of sorting everyday possessions and watching cluttered rooms gradually become warm, expressive living spaces. Its cat-led perspective gives the experience a playful charm, while the underlying stories of change and connection lend the calm presentation some emotional weight. The mood stays cozy and unhurried rather than demanding, making it an ideal palate cleanser after louder, more competitive games.
Players examine more than a thousand household objects, categorize them, and decide where each belongs across rooms that evolve as the journey continues. The central loop is deliberately simple: clear disorder, arrange items in sensible or visually pleasing ways, and use the results to reveal details about the people connected to each space. There are no countdowns, combat encounters, health systems, or leaderboard pressures interrupting the process, so experimentation matters more than efficiency. Guidance from the game’s Meow-ster tutors helps keep the organization mechanics approachable, while the changing décor and environmental clues provide a steady sense of progression.
What separates Organized Inside from a basic cleaning simulator is its focus on personal storytelling through objects and interior design. Five strangers’ lives unfold indirectly, encouraging players to read meaning into what they keep, hide, display, or leave in disarray instead of simply ticking off chores. Its relaxed, tactile appeal should click with fans of Unpacking, although the cat-centered framing and broader life-sim sensibility give it its own softer identity. Meticulous players can enjoy finding an ideal place for everything, while creative organizers can treat each room as a small visual narrative; newcomers to cozy games are just as welcome as genre regulars.
